You are creating a one-of-a-kind glittered unicorn horn for your horse, Bart. You want to build a cone that is 12 inches tall with a radius of 2 inches. When you go to the store, you find out that the silver glitter you want to buy is $0.75 per square inch. How much it cost to fully cover the unicorn horn with silver glitter? Make sure to round your answer to the nearest square inch and show all of the steps of your solution.
